- [ ] **Step 7: Breaker override escrow.** After sealing the signing keys for the Tallgrove upstream API circuit breaker, confirm the support team can force the breaker open during a full outage. The override bundle lives in the sealed escrow drawer and is useless without its unlock phrase. Two ceremony witnesses must initial this step before proceeding. The escrow bundle is decrypted with the recovery passphrase that follows.

vault phrase of kahip-kahop = holath-quenmir

The Parcelpine webhook service receives delivery-status events from carrier partners and fans them out to downstream consumers. It deploys as a single stateless container behind the Thistlegate load balancer; three replicas in production, one in staging. Deploys are rolling, so in-flight webhooks are retried automatically by the sender — no drain step needed. New team members should note that signature verification is mandatory and cannot be disabled outside local dev. Each environment is provisioned with the configuration values below.

settings of tagef-bawif:
DRUIX_HOST=druix.zemvarlabs.internal
DRUIX_PORT=8000

## Releases

Heads up for reviewers: the driver-assignment heuristic in Courier Loom is version-pinned, so any tweak to the scoring weights bumps the minor version. Run `loom-sim replay` on last week's traffic before approving — regressions in pickup latency are easy to miss in unit tests. Release bundles get signed before upload; use the key below.

signing key of bagap-yawep = bky13_TbfT6ZMUoGJo2